In 2025, short haircuts for women are making waves, marking it as the year of the bob. The trends range from the playful wolfcut and chic lob to the contemporary puffy bob. Miu Miu’s fall 2025 collection, showcased by Miuccia Prada, introduced new cropped hair silhouettes that challenged traditional notions of femininity.
Prada posed a profound question during the show: “Do we need femininity in this challenging era to uplift our spirits?” She probed what elements of femininity remain essential today, highlighting accessories such as bras, brooches, and furs, urging us to contemplate their significance.
For many, a short haircut evokes memories of a grandmother or an elderly relative, often characterized by a structured shape that graces the nape of the neck—much like my own grandmother. She had a dedicated routine of visiting the salon weekly to maintain her favored style, secured with layers of hairspray. This look quickly sprang to my mind as I witnessed Prada’s eclectic yet stylish presentation.

The collection embodied a playful twist on the bourgeois Milanese aesthetic, featuring vivid knee socks, skin-hugging lurex sweaters, bias-cut slip skirts, faux fur stoles, and conical bras. As noted by Sarah Mower in her Vogue Runway review here, Prada’s nod to the 1950s is not new, yet the beauty elements this season felt particularly striking.
Exploring the Modern Take on the Miu Miu Grandma Cut

The models sported haircuts that were steeped in nostalgia yet reinvented for a contemporary audience. The styles varied in lengths: ear-length cuts, shoulder-length with inward-turned ends, and cropped backs. This modern interpretation of the classic Italian nonna haircut from the ’50s leans towards uniformity, allowing for fullness and texture while still being low-maintenance.
The secret to achieving this look lies not only in the haircut’s length and volume but also in its styling. Achieve maximum height at the roots with a blowout using a large round brush. Embrace a slightly stiff and product-heavy finish; don’t hesitate to apply thickening mousse, cream, or hairspray generously. The ideal aesthetic is triangular and sculptural, with face-framing pieces elegantly positioned above the hairline.
There’s a certain strength in reclaiming this “frumpy” style—it radiates confidence and a deep understanding of one’s own identity and fashion preferences. Just like our beloved matriarchs, such a look embodies resilience.
